Runbook — Quota enforcement, Plugline platform. Plugin authors: per-tenant rate quotas are enforced at the gateway, not in your plugin. Do not retry on 429 faster than the Retry-After header allows; repeated violations suspend the plugin. To test quota behavior locally, run the Plugline sandbox with QUOTA_TIER set to the tier you're targeting and QUOTA_TENANT set to your sandbox tenant. The line after those two entries sets the sandbox auth secret.

env line for fafof-fahag: LEDGER_TOKEN5=f8790

**PR: Backoff tuning for AgriLink gateway retries**

Hey folks — this bumps the retry ceiling on the AgriLink telemetry gateway so combines in patchy coverage don't drop packets so fast. Nothing fancy, just saner defaults after last week's harvest-season flood. For context, the new values are listed here.

tuning constants:
QUOTAS = {
    "quenael": 10,
    "oliwyn": 1,
}

## Configuration — DedupeHawk

Set MATCH_THRESHOLD (default 0.92) and MERGE_BATCH_SIZE (default 500). Lower the threshold only if the Falstown dataset backlog grows; false merges are hard to undo. DRY_RUN=true is mandatory for first runs on any new tenant. The merge worker calls the records vault with a service credential, set on the following line:

secret setting of fawep-tagaf: ARCHIVE_KEY3=ce5

## Deployment

Formulabox evaluates user-supplied formulas inside a locked-down sandbox. Plugin authors: your formulas never touch the host filesystem, network, or clock — don't design around them. Deploy the sandbox runner as its own process per tenant; never share a runner across trust boundaries. CPU and memory caps are enforced at the runner level, and exceeding them kills the evaluation, not the host. Ship your plugin against the stable ABI only. The runner must be started with the following configuration values.

deployment values, faduf-tawep:
SORDOR_LOG_LEVEL=error
SORDOR_METRICS_HOST=metrics.sordor.nelvrolabs.internal
SORDOR_POOL_SIZE=4